Master of Forensic Accounting and Financial Crime

The Master of Forensic Accounting and Financial Crime is a Masters Degree (Coursework) course from Macquarie University (Macquarie). The CRICOS code for this course is 099170G. The main language of Master of Forensic Accounting and Financial Crime is English.

In Australia, training providers must be approved for registration on the Commonwealth Register of Institutions and Courses for Overseas Students (CRICOS) before they can teach overseas students. The Master of Forensic Accounting and Financial Crime is an approved CRICOS course from Macquarie University (Macquarie).

The field of studies for Master of Forensic Accounting and Financial Crime is Management and Commerce, Accounting and Accounting.

Course Duration

The Course duration on CRICOS must accurately reflect the time taken by a student to complete the course including any reasonable compulsory periods of orientation.

Course duration78 weeks / 1.5 years

The total course duration for Master of Forensic Accounting and Financial Crime is around 78 weeks. The registered duration cannot exceed the time required for completing the course on the basis of the normal amount of full-time study, and must not include any period of work-based training unless this is necessary in order to obtain the course qualification. Course duration should not include the period between when assessments or examinations for the course have been completed, and the time when results become available.

This course does not include any work component as part of the registered course. Work component hours (WIL hours) that are formally registered as part of the course are not included in the fortnight limitation.
